What is the “Achievement Gap”?
By 4th grade, African-American
  and Latino students are, on
average, nearly three academic
years behind their white peers. 
Only 10% of students at Tier 1
colleges (146 most selective) come
from the bottom half of the income
           distribution.
Barely half of African-American, Latino, and
  Native American students graduate from
high school, with African American students
 graduating at 54%, Latinos at 56%, Native
     Americans at 51% and their white
            counterparts at 77%.

WHAT DO SFER MEMBERS DO?
act as policy advocates: SFER members support
pro-student state legislation while learning about
the “politics of education reform”

raise campus awareness: SFER members host guest
speakers, table, and host educational events such
as film screenings and “dinner discussions” where
members can discuss issues in ed reform and
optional or assigned reading- often with invited
professors, graduate, or undergraduate students
collaborate with other campus SFER groups as well
as work with the national organization and its
partners, the Done Waiting Coalition and National
School Choice Week

visit schools at high performing schools in
traditionally disadvantaged or low-performing
districts including: Excel Academy, Roxbury Prep,
KIPP RISE Academy, KIPP SPARK, North Star
Academy, and Harlem Children’s Zone Promise
Academy, among others.

WHAT DOES SFER BELIEVE?

SFER Believes          in High Expectations
“We believe that all students, regardless of race or
background, are capable of achieving at a high level.
While we recognize the challenges of poverty, we
believe that a great education is the first step for a
student to succeed — a school must not abandon its
primary mission of providing an excellent education
for its students.”
